A Cable That Actually Stops the Noise
This is not just a piece of wire. It is a high-performance tool for your machine. We use a double-shielded design to kill electromagnetic interference (EMI). Inside, you have two cores at 0.34 square millimeters for power or main signals. You also have two cores at 0.23 square millimeters for data or control signals. We wrap these cores in a foil shield. Then, we add a braided copper shield on top. This two-layer defense stops noise from motors, welders, and other heavy equipment. Your signals stay clean. Your system runs smooth. Technical Specifications You Can Trust
We believe in transparency. Here are the exact specs for this 4-core shielded signal control cable:
- Conductor Structure: 2 cores x 0.34 mm² + 2 cores x 0.23 mm² (Stranded bare copper).
- Shielding: Aluminum foil + Tinned copper braid (Coverage > 85%).
- Insulation: PVC or specialized flexible compound (Color coded for easy ID).
- Outer Jacket: High-flex PVC/PUR (Black, Orange, or custom).
- Voltage Rating: 300V / 500V (Suitable for control circuits).
- Temperature Range: -40°C to +80°C (Flexible in cold, stable in heat).
- Bending Radius: 6x to 8x cable diameter (Very flexible).
- Application: Class I industrial installations, signal transmission, sensor wiring.
- Certifications: CE, RoHS, ISO 9001 compliant.
Where This Cable Shines: Real-World Use Cases
You might ask, “Where exactly do I use this?” The answer is simple: anywhere you need clean signals and high movement.
- Robotic Arms: The cable moves with the joint. It needs to be flexible and shielded.
- CNC Machines: Servo motors and encoders need noise-free signals to position accurately.
- Conveyor Systems: Sensors along the line need to communicate without interference from the motor drives.
- Packaging Machinery: High-speed movement requires cables that do not snag or break.
- Outdoor Control Boxes: The UV-resistant jacket handles sun and rain.
